TRANSFORMATIONAL LEADERSHIP MANAGEMENT AT STATE ISLAMIC JUNIOR HIGH SCHOOL Azzuhri, Usamah; Zaki Ulien Nuha

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the application of transformational leadership management by madrasah principals and its contribution to the realization of an excellent madrasah at MTs N 2 Kota Kediri. The study uses a descriptive qualitative approach to gain an in-depth understanding of transformational leadership practices in the natural context of madrasahs. The research subjects included the principal, teachers, staff, and students who were selected purposively based on their direct involvement in the leadership and educational management processes. Data were collected through in-depth interviews, observations, and documentation, then analyzed using Miles and Huberman's interactive model, which includes data reduction, data presentation, and conclusion drawing. The results of the study show that transformational leadership at MTs N 2 Kota Kediri is carried out in an integrated manner with managerial functions and is based on religious values. The madrasah principal acts as a driver of change through exemplary behavior, inspirational motivation, intellectual stimulation, and consistent individual attention. The application of this leadership has an impact on strengthening the school culture, increasing teacher motivation and commitment, creating a safe and conducive learning environment, and developing the character and achievements of students. This study concludes that transformational leadership management contributes significantly to building an excellent madrasah that not only emphasizes academic achievement but also character building, educator quality, and educational quality sustainability. PENGUATAN KOMPETENSI PEMBELAJARAN GURU TPQ UNTUK MENINGKATKAN KUALITAS PENDIDIKAN AL-QUR’AN DI TPQ AL HIDAYAH DESA PACAREJO Muhammad Naufal Wiksa Wikrama; Najmi Fauzan Amril; Mugar Rindi; Zaki Ulien Nuha; Maryono

Abstract

This community service program aims to strengthen the instructional competence of teachers at TPQ Al Hidayah, Pacarejo Village, through tahsin training and reinforcement of tajwid understanding in order to support teachers’ readiness for Ummi Method certification. The program was implemented using the Asset-Based Community Development (ABCD) approach, which positions teachers as the main assets of the community. The methods employed included initial observation, deliberation with TPQ administrators, participatory training sessions, and program evaluation. The training process involved the delivery of tajwid materials, guided Qur’an reading practices, direct feedback, and reflective discussions. The results indicate a significant improvement in teachers’ competencies, particularly in the accuracy of Qur’anic recitation, application of tajwid rules, and the ability to independently identify and correct recitation errors. In addition, teachers demonstrated increased confidence in guiding students, and two teachers were identified as having strong potential to be recommended for Ummi Method certification. The program also produced a sustainability plan in the form of regular tahsin sessions to ensure continuous improvement in the quality of Qur’anic education at TPQ Al Hidayah.
OPTIMALISASI PEMBELAJARAN IQRA’ PADA TPQ UBAY BIN KA‘AB MELALUI PENDEKATAN BERBASIS KOMUNITAS Fanny Hasbi Assyidiqi; Mohammad Imam Safe'i; Muhammad Yufri Bramantio Aly; Zaki Ulien Nuha; Maryono

Abstract

This community engagement program aims to optimize Iqra’ learning at TPQ Ubay bin Ka’ab through a community-based approach (Asset-Based Community Development/ABCD) in Padukuhan Jasem, Pacarejo, Gunungkidul. The program was initiated in response to the mismatch between students’ actual reading abilities and their assigned Iqra’ levels, which affected the effectiveness of Qur’anic learning. This study employed a descriptive qualitative approach within a community service framework. Data were collected through observation, interviews, documentation, and placement tests involving 30 students and two teachers. The intervention included conducting placement tests, regrouping students according to their real abilities, standardizing a 60-minute learning structure, adding learning sessions, and providing teacher mentoring in tajwid and makharijul huruf. The results indicate significant improvement in students’ reading fluency, accuracy in pronunciation, and understanding of long and short vowel rules. In addition, teachers demonstrated greater consistency in correcting recitation based on proper tajwid principles. The ABCD approach effectively strengthened community participation and institutional awareness, leading to a more structured and sustainable Qur’anic learning system.
